THE IMPACT OF THE DIFFERENCE IN OIL VISCOSITY OF OILS ON THEIR MIXING DURING SEQUENTIAL PUMPING IN THE PIPELINES

There has been made the analysis of an impact of difference in oil viscosity on the volume of the mixture that is formed during their sequential pipage. The calculations are made for a real pipeline system for different combinations of pump inclusion in stations for a wide range of variation of oil viscosity. There has been worked out an algorithm for determining the throughput capacity of oil-trunk pipelines at different oil viscosities used for calculation the volume of the mixture. It is proved that the volume of the mixture increases when the difference of oil viscosity increases. Intensive growth of the mixture volume occurs at low viscosity values.
